    Default Sun and moon ??

    Hi guys, I am not too sure about this one .........
    Not sure what I was thinking when turning this piece !
    Is it woodturning or art or just crap ! and a waste of time ?
    Anyhoo it,s rosewood "moon " not sure what the sphere was made from and a burl base
    With a 6mm aluminum rod to hold everything together
    I would like to know what others think , any criticism and advice welcome as always
